It seems like latest HyperV sets _ADR to 0 in the ACPI for the VMBS

that's a hardly a good reason to add this.
To me looks like a pointless addition,
_ADR mostly is used when device resides on a bus with standard ennumeration
algorithm (i.e. PCI, ...).

Value is also wrong  for the bus it's placed currently,
and with the next patch it won't make a sense altogether.

Pls, drop this patch unless Windows refuses to work without it.


Windows seems to handle fine without this.
